With a focus on both theory and practical application, this program equips students with the necessary skills to excel in various roles within the industry. 1. **Director**: As a documentary director, you'll be responsible for overseeing the entire production process, from pre-production to post-production. Your role involves making critical creative decisions, working closely with the cast and crew, and ensuring the project remains on schedule and within budget. 2. **Cinematographer**: Cinematographers, also known as directors of photography, are responsible for capturing the visual elements of a documentary. They work closely with the director to create a visually appealing film, selecting appropriate cameras, lenses, and lighting equipment to achieve the desired aesthetic. 3. **Editor**: Editors play a crucial role in shaping the narrative of a documentary. By carefully selecting and arranging footage, audio, and special effects, editors help create a cohesive and engaging story that resonates with the audience. 4. **Producer**: Producers are responsible for managing the business and financial aspects of a documentary production. This includes securing funding, hiring key personnel, coordinating schedules, and ensuring the project stays on track to meet its intended release date. 5. **Sound Designer**: Sound designers craft the auditory landscape of a documentary, ensuring that the audio elements complement the visuals and enhance the overall viewing experience. This includes capturing location audio, creating sound effects, and mixing dialogue to produce a polished final product.
